Don't forget the car seat, stroller, high chair, crib & mattress. With the big ticket items people will buy in groups of friends to divide the cost. Also, you can purchase with gift cards that you get if no one actually purchased them.
Scan the things you really wouldn't want to have to pay for yourself. I'd have a good range as far as prices are concerned, but stay away from the small things. The more tiny junk you register for, the less likely you'll be to get what you really need. I wouldn't register for clothes; you'll get those anyway.
